Philipp Wolfer
|
1fd305c9fe
|
Github Actions: Do not trigger builds on tag / branch create
Limiting this to specific tags / branches seems unsupported, also it seems that tag pushes still trigger the build.
|
2019-11-29 07:43:47 +01:00 |
|
Philipp Wolfer
|
39511dca00
|
Github Actions: Fixed triggering macOS builds on packaging script changes
|
2019-11-28 12:43:32 +01:00 |
|
Philipp Wolfer
|
af68e3fb29
|
Github Actions: Run picard -V after pip install test
|
2019-11-28 08:09:08 +01:00 |
|
Philipp Wolfer
|
d4f4ac0f8f
|
Github Actions: Run test suite on all pushes
|
2019-11-27 10:10:33 +01:00 |
|
Philipp Wolfer
|
77ca6a7bc5
|
Github Actions: Ensure win / mac builds are triggered for release tags
|
2019-11-27 10:09:52 +01:00 |
|
Philipp Wolfer
|
89d6097125
|
Github Actions: Run tests even if code style validation fails
The test suite will still fail, but we get all issues reported instead of just code style issues.
|
2019-11-27 08:57:14 +01:00 |
|
Philipp Wolfer
|
a4c123bc25
|
Github Actions: Limit paths for which to run tests / packaging
|
2019-11-27 07:58:29 +01:00 |
|
Philipp Wolfer
|
c4f9ced825
|
Github Actions: Test clean pip install from source
|
2019-11-26 16:41:15 +01:00 |
|
Philipp Wolfer
|
52c6632354
|
Github Actions: Setup macOS code signing
|
2019-11-26 16:41:15 +01:00 |
|
Philipp Wolfer
|
23759d8818
|
Github Actions: Submit code coverage reports to Codacy
|
2019-11-26 16:41:15 +01:00 |
|
Philipp Wolfer
|
a24e84f3bd
|
Github Actions: Add git commit hash to version for non-release builds
|
2019-11-26 16:41:14 +01:00 |
|
Philipp Wolfer
|
7827b1bf16
|
Github Actions: Use Get-PfxCertificate to open code sign certificate
Import-PfxCertificate is not available on Github Actions.
|
2019-11-26 16:41:14 +01:00 |
|
Philipp Wolfer
|
05bcd89b0e
|
Github Actions: Windows code signing
|
2019-11-26 16:41:14 +01:00 |
|
Philipp Wolfer
|
69af7e326d
|
Github Actions: Upload artifacts to Github releases
|
2019-11-26 16:41:14 +01:00 |
|
Philipp Wolfer
|
c43020973d
|
Github Actions: Upload build artifacts
|
2019-11-26 16:41:14 +01:00 |
|
Philipp Wolfer
|
e2e3c1d7cd
|
Github Actions: Package Windows app
|
2019-11-26 16:41:14 +01:00 |
|
Philipp Wolfer
|
1ce769983f
|
Github Actions: Package macOS app
|
2019-11-26 16:41:14 +01:00 |
|
Philipp Wolfer
|
94fa88266b
|
Run tests with Github Actions
|
2019-11-26 13:12:43 +01:00 |
|
Philipp Wolfer
|
275f3023eb
|
Simplified Github pull request template
Github will now automatically link PICARD-XXX correctly.
|
2019-10-25 16:54:42 +02:00 |
|
Philipp Wolfer
|
2bf98913fc
|
Create FUNDING.yml
|
2019-09-18 15:06:38 +02:00 |
|
Sambhav Kothari
|
576dd44ed6
|
Add a PR template
|
2017-12-23 02:49:35 +05:30 |
|